The battle royale community is abuzz over PUBG New State, the futuristic evolution of PlayerUnknown's Battlegrounds. As launch day nears, an APK version has appeared on TapTap—but it's not verified by developers.
PUBG New State has hooked mobile gamers with its explosive trailer, delivering high-stakes virtual battles and groundbreaking graphics that elevate mobile gaming. Slated for November, it boasts 50 million pre-registrations, surging further since opening in India.

Krafton wrapped up the final technical test for PUBG New State today, inviting only Second Alpha Test participants. Yet, prominent Indian creators like Mortal and Scout snagged early access.

In this hype, the APK popped up on TapTap, a go-to platform for Android gamers offering thousands of quality titles. It claims to provide tech test access for early play—but it's unauthorized.

With devs limiting tests to select players, steer clear of this APK to protect your device. Wait for the official November 11, 2021 release instead.
